Subject: Running Barebox in Barebox.
Date: Mon, 28 Nov 2011 14:25:20 +0000 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<4ED399D0.7020302@ge.com> (raw)
I have seen an example of tftp loading barebox in /dev/ram0
and then running it with the go command.
Is that something that has been tested with the MPC5200?
Else is there a good example to achieve this?
